What Is the Shoprite Retail Readiness Programme?

The Shoprite Retail Readiness Programme (RRP) is a structured learnership that combines theoretical classroom training with practical in-store experience. The programme aims to provide participants with the skills and knowledge required to work effectively in retail environments, including Shoprite, Checkers, and Usave stores.

The RRP lasts for seven weeks, divided into two key components:

  • Three weeks of classroom-based theoretical training
  • Four weeks of practical, on-the-job training in a retail store

Upon successful completion of the programme, learners receive an NQF Level 3 qualification, which is nationally recognized and can significantly improve employability within the retail sector.


Who Is Eligible to Apply?

To apply for the Shoprite Retail Readiness Programme, candidates must meet several important criteria:

  • Age: Between 18 and 34 years old
  • Education: Minimum of Grade 10, though a Matric certificate (Grade 12) is highly advantageous
  • Residency: Must be a South African citizen
  • Work Experience: No prior retail or work experience is necessary
  • Availability: Willingness to work shifts, weekends, and public holidays as required
  • Other Requirements: Reliable transport to and from work, good communication skills, and a willingness to learn and work as part of a team

The programme is specifically targeted at unemployed youth to help bridge the gap between education and employment.


What Will You Learn?

During the Retail Readiness Programme, participants are exposed to key aspects of retail operations, including:

  • Customer service skills: how to engage with customers effectively and professionally
  • Stock control and inventory management
  • Cash handling and point-of-sale operations
  • Health and safety regulations in a retail environment
  • Product knowledge and merchandising
  • Basic financial literacy related to retail

The practical component allows learners to apply what they have learned in a real-world environment under the supervision of experienced retail managers and mentors.


How to Apply for the Shoprite Retail Readiness Programme

There are several ways to apply for the RRP:

  1. WhatsApp Application
    Candidates can send a message to the dedicated WhatsApp number: 087 240 5709. Follow the prompts by selecting “Job Opportunities,” and then complete the application process as directed.
  2. In-Person Application
    Visit your nearest Shoprite, Checkers, or Usave store and submit your CV at the customer service desk. Store managers often assist candidates in registering for the programme.
  3. Online Application
    Applications may also be submitted through the official Shoprite careers website under the “Youth Opportunities” or “Learnerships” sections.

Since this is a highly sought-after programme, it’s advisable to apply as early as possible once applications open.


Benefits of Joining the Retail Readiness Programme

Participating in the Shoprite Retail Readiness Programme comes with multiple benefits:

  • Nationally Recognized Qualification: Gain an NQF Level 3 certificate that boosts your employability.
  • Practical Work Experience: Develop hands-on skills that are valued in retail jobs.
  • Career Opportunities: Many graduates of the programme are offered permanent employment within Shoprite, Checkers, or Usave stores.
  • Workplace Readiness: Learn vital soft skills such as teamwork, communication, time management, and professionalism.
  • Networking: Build relationships with industry professionals and potential employers.

Overall, this programme acts as a stepping stone for young South Africans seeking a sustainable career in retail or related industries.


Additional Opportunities at Shoprite

Besides the Retail Readiness Programme, Shoprite also offers other initiatives aimed at youth development, including:

  • Bursaries: Financial support for students pursuing tertiary qualifications in fields like Accounting, Retail Management, Supply Chain, and Food Science.
  • Youth Employment Services (YES) Programme: Partnerships with businesses to create employment pathways for unemployed youth.

These programmes reflect Shoprite’s commitment to empowering South African youth through education, skills development, and employment.
